    Abstract: The invention provides a method for improving sarcopenia of a subject in need thereof by using Phellinus linteus, in which the method includes administering an effective dose of composition to the subject, and the composition includes Phellinus linteus (NITE BP-03321 and BCRC 930210) as an effective substance. By using the aforementioned composition including an extract of a fermented product of the Phellinus linteus and/or its derivative, diameters of myotubes, amounts of muscles and muscle muscular endurance can be maintained, thereby improving sarcopenia.

    Abstract: A support frame for clamping a rod includes two gripping assemblies. The gripping assembly includes a seat, two gripping blocks, two connecting members, a first adjusting screw and a second adjusting screw. The seat has a first through hole. The gripping block is slidably connected to the seat and has a hole body, a gripping notch and a long trough corresponding to the first through hole. The connecting member is disposed on the gripping block and has a first threaded hole corresponding to the first through hole. The first adjusting screw passes through the first through hole and the long trough to screw to the first threaded hole. A gripping recess is formed between the gripping notches of the gripping blocks. The two gripping assemblies jointly grip the rod by the gripping recesses. The second adjusting screw passes through and screws to the hole bodes of the gripping assemblies.

    Abstract: A panel supporting device with elevating function includes a supporting frame, a supporting sleeve, a guiding cover member, a driving block, a lead screw and a positioning liner. The supporting frame includes a plurality of guiding posts. The supporting sleeve is disposed between the guiding posts and connected to the panel. The guiding cover member fixedly covers an outside of the supporting sleeve and has a plurality of guiding holes in which the guiding posts penetrate. The driving block is fixed inside the supporting sleeve and has a screw hole and an inserting slot. The lead screw is accommodated inside the supporting sleeve and screwed in the screw hole. The positioning liner is accommodated inside the supporting sleeve and penetrates the inserting slot, thereby preventing the supporting sleeve from tilting or vibrating during up and down movement.

    Abstract: A rotating shaft structure for a supporting frame is used for supporting a thin computer or a plate screen. The rotating shaft structure includes a carrying base, a supporting arm, and a connecting base. The carrying base is fastened on a wall or a column. Bearings are placed into the first sleeve and the second sleeve located at the two opposite sides of the supporting arm. The carrying base is steadily pivoted with the supporting arm via the first locking assembly. The connecting base is steadily pivoted with the supporting arm via the second locking assembly. Because the bearings are placed in the first sleeve and the second sleeve, the first locking assembly and the second locking assembly are merely used as a locking element, and the bearing fully supports the rotating shaft when the supporting arm rotates. The connecting base is used for connecting with a thin electronic device.

    Abstract: A mounting arm is used to support the thin type electronic products such as thin type computer or flat panel displayer. The mounting arm comprises a bearing base, a first support arm, a second support arm, and a pedestal. The bearing base is fixed on a wall or a pillar, the first support arm is pivotally engaged with the bearing base, the second support arm is pivotally engaged with the first support arm, the pedestal is pivotally engaged with the second support arm, and the pedestal is connected with the thin type electronic product. Furthermore, each of the first support arm and the second support arm has an oblique surface, and the oblique surface of the first support arm faced and mated with the oblique surface of the second support arm so as to reduce the occupation space when the second support arm is overlapped up the first support arm.

    Abstract: A hanging support apparatus has the angle-adjusting function. The hanging support apparatus hangs a device on a wall and includes a base fastened and connected to the wall, and a hanging body fastened and connected to the handed device. The base includes two side walls and a top wall. A plurality of locking elements are located on the top wall. The hanging body includes two side walls, a top wall, and a receiving space located between the side walls and the top wall. A plurality of slots are located on the top wall. The receiving space receives the base. The side walls of the hanging body are pivoted with the side walls of the base. The hanging body uses the pivoting location as a shaft and allows it to rotate. The plurality of locking elements locks the angle between the hanging body and the base via the slots.
